Developer Content definition

Developer Content means the documentation, resources, and sample code accessible via the ConnectWise Developer Network from time to time.
Developer Content means all data, code, trade secrets, patents, designs, drawings, text created by Developer for use on the Site, including any modifications or enhancements provided by Developer.
Developer Content means all of your App(s) and/or Plug-in(s), together with all of their related Deliverables.

Developer Content means all text, information, data, software, executable code, images, audio or video material, in whatever medium or form, relevant for the purpose of using, developing or maintaining any Solution, and all information related to End-Users processed or stored by any Solution.
Developer Content means the articles, white papers, webinars, RSS feeds, newsletters, documentation, books, publications, resources, and sample code accessible via Developerforce, but excluding Code Share Content.
Developer Content means any articles, white papers, webinars, RSS feeds, newsletters, documentation, books, publications, resources and sample code owned by Salesforce and made available by Salesforce through the Salesforce Developers Site, excluding any Pre-Release Products, Developer Tools and xxxxxxxxxx.xxx development platforms. “Developer Tools” means any tools and toolkits owned by Salesforce and made available by Salesforce through the Salesforce Developers Site, excluding any Pre-Release Products and xxxxxxxxxx.xxx development platforms.
Developer Content means any content that You provide in Your Developed Application, including data, images, video, or software. Your Content does not include the Content.
Developer Content means any content that you provide in your Module, including data, images, video or software. Developer Content does not include any information, data or material provided to you by PBSI through SSA or through other software or data products provided to you under license from PBSI.
Developer Content means the articles, white papers, webinars, documentation, publications, resources, and sample code accessible via the Coupa Development Site.
